The issue is the vectorizer doesn't currently handle conversions: t.c:20:5: note: Analyze phi: sum_102 = PHI <0(6), sum_75(7)> t.c:20:5: note: reduction: not commutative/associative: sum_75 = (int) _61; I have patches to fix that though.
